The market leader in extrusion blow molding technology accounted for 37.0% of global revenue in 2020. Extrusion is relatively cheaper than other processes, so it is widely used in bulk production of packaging products, cans, and bottles.
Because of the lower pressure required in the former, extrusion blow mould costs are lower than injection blow mold. Extrusion also has a lower machinery cost, which is a plus. This process also makes molding external threads easy and inexpensive. It is expected to be the fastest-growing technology sector over the forecast period.
Injection blow molding allows for the production of more complicated products in a variety of designs and shapes. However, the price of the final products will be significantly higher. Companies can increase their production output by using injection blow molding in a shorter amount of time and have greater flexibility in the design and materials they can use. The segment's growth may be hindered by heavy machinery design which takes up more space and is expensive.
The stretch blow molding technology is used to produce high-quality, clear bottles. It has been limited in use. Because compound blow molding is used to produce high-performance, customized components for automobiles, the automotive industry is driving demand. Future demand is expected to be driven by the increasing demand for lightweight, specialized parts for both OEM and aftermarket markets.
The market leader in polyethylene (PE), accounted for over 20.0% of global revenue in 2020. This large share can be attributed to the increasing use of PE compounds within the packaging and electrical and electronics industries. The main uses of PE compounds are in packaging different types of products such as chemical and food products.
Construction is another major use for PE compounds, along with the packaging industry. For prototype development using Computer Numerical Control (CNC), machines and 3D printers, polyethylene is used. HDPE (High-density Polyethylene) is easy to process, has a high moisture barrier, and can be used to make opaque and hollow packaging products. Low-density Polyethylene is preferred, depending on the application field, because of its low cost of production and heat-sealability, high clarity, high elongation and softness.
Over the forecast period, Polyethylene Terephthalate's (PET), packaging demand is expected to increase. Recent advances in PET bottle recycling and disposal have overcome the restrictions imposed by regulations. Bio-based PET will allow for internal substitution and is expected to drive demand in many applications. It is used extensively in plastic bottling for soft drinks, as well as specialty bottling such as beer bottling. Because of some of its properties, it is ideal for flexible food packaging or thermal insulation. It is often used as a substrate for thin-film solar cell.

Different regulatory bodies have established guidelines for packaging materials used in food contact applications. BPA (bisphenol A) is a common ingredient in the production of plastics and epoxy resins. It has been subject to intense regulatory scrutiny due to its presence within plastics such as polycarbonate and PVC. Flexible packaging is where polypropylene (PP), which is used primarily for certain food and confectionery items, as well as clothing and tobacco.
It is also used in flexible packaging. It can also be used in consumer products such as automotive and household goods, including furniture, appliances, luggage, housewares, and other applications. Plastic vehicle parts are preferred by many automobile manufacturers. They allow for low production costs and help increase the company's bottom line profit margin.
